Provide comprehensive nursing care to patients and families by implementing individualized care plans based on physical and psychological assessments. Support the organization's mission through collaboration and adherence to professional nursing standards and patient-centered care models.
Requires a Registered Nurse license and at least one year of nursing experience. A nursing diploma or associate degree is required, while a bachelor's degree in nursing is preferred.
